Mandy, the waitress played by Donna Benedicto, had to be one of the foremost fun roles within the recent Supernatural episode “Stuck within the Middle (With You).” Not only did she work with Richard Speight Jr., but also observe the everyday banter of our leads …. Donna has also been in iZombie, Almost Human, and Motive.
